The MC 2000T2 is characterized by its high-resolution system, which allows for consistent quality regardless of character size. Power Supply: 110/220V, 50/60Hz. Display: 320x240 pixel grey scale screen.
The COUTH MC 2000T2 is a next-generation electronic control unit designed to manage all COUTH MC 2000 series marking machines. It represents a significant leap forward, incorporating the best features of previous controllers while integrating cutting-edge technological improvements. This standalone unit does not require a PC for basic operation, though it offers robust PC connectivity for advanced tasks. couth mc 2000t2 manual upd
